Ingredients You’ll Need

Gathering these ingredients is part of the fun! They are simple and wholesome—perfect for whipping up this delightful salad.

For the Salad

  • 8 ounces dry protein pasta
  • 2 5-ounce cans albacore tuna in water
  • 1 15.5-ounce can of white kidney beans, drained
  • 4 large hard-boiled eggs
  • 2 scallions, thinly sliced
  • 1 cup frozen peas

For the Creamy Dressing

  • 1 cup whole milk cottage cheese
  • 1/2 cup mayonnaise (we use Duke’s)
  • 2-4 tbsp apple cider vinegar
  • 2 tsp Dijon mustard
  • 1 tsp dried dill
  • 1 tsp garlic powder
  • 1 tsp onion powder
  • 1/2 tsp black pepper
  • Salt to taste

How to Make Easy Tuna Pasta Salad

Step 1: Cook the Pasta

Start by boiling water in a large pot. Once it’s bubbling away, add your dry protein pasta. Cooking it until al dente is key—it helps maintain some bite in your salad. Remember to drain and rinse the pasta under cold water afterward; this prevents it from becoming mushy when mixed with the dressing.

Step 2: Prepare Your Ingredients

While your pasta cooks, it’s time to chop and slice! Dice up those hard-boiled eggs and thinly slice your scallions. If you’re using frozen peas, give them a quick rinse under warm water to thaw them out. Having everything prepped makes mixing so much easier!

Step 3: Mix It All Together

In a large mixing bowl, combine your cooked pasta with tuna, kidney beans, eggs, scallions, and peas. In another bowl, whisk together cottage cheese, mayonnaise, vinegar, mustard, dill, garlic powder, onion powder, black pepper, and salt until smooth. This creamy dressing ties all the flavors together beautifully!

Step 4: Combine & Chill

Pour the dressing over your pasta mixture. Gently fold everything together until well-coated—be careful not to mash those lovely eggs! Once mixed well, cover your bowl and let it chill in the fridge for at least 15 minutes before serving. This allows all those delicious flavors to meld together perfectly!

Pro Tips for Making Easy Tuna Pasta Salad

Making the perfect easy tuna pasta salad is all about the details! Here are some tips to elevate your dish and make it even more delicious.

  • Cook pasta al dente: This ensures that the pasta maintains its texture and doesn’t become mushy when mixed with the other ingredients. Al dente pasta adds a nice bite and helps the salad hold up in the fridge.
  • Use high-quality tuna: Opt for albacore tuna packed in water for the best flavor and texture. Quality tuna makes a noticeable difference in taste, giving your salad a fresher, more satisfying bite.
  • Let it chill: After mixing all your ingredients, let the salad sit in the refrigerator for at least 30 minutes before serving. Chilling allows the flavors to meld together beautifully, enhancing overall taste.
  • Adjust seasoning to your taste: Don’t hesitate to tweak the salt, pepper, or vinegar levels according to your preference. Personalizing the seasoning will make this salad truly yours!
  • Add fresh herbs: Tossing in some chopped parsley or basil right before serving adds a burst of freshness and color, making your dish pop visually and flavor-wise.

Easy Tuna Pasta Salad

  • Author: Arianna
  • Prep Time: 15 minutes
  • Cook Time: 10 minutes
  • Total Time: 25 minutes
  • Yield: Serves approximately 6
  • Category: Main
  • Method: Mixing
  • Cuisine: American

Ingredients

Scale
  • 8 ounces dry protein pasta
  • 2 5-ounce cans albacore tuna in water
  • 1 15.5-ounce can of white kidney beans, drained
  • 4 large hard-boiled eggs
  • 2 scallions, thinly sliced
  • 1 cup frozen peas
  • 1 cup whole milk cottage cheese
  • 1/2 cup mayonnaise
  • 24 tbsp apple cider vinegar
  • 2 tsp Dijon mustard
  • 1 tsp dried dill
  • 1 tsp garlic powder
  • 1 tsp onion powder
  • 1/2 tsp black pepper
  • Salt to taste

Instructions

  1. Cook the pasta according to package instructions until al dente; drain and rinse under cold water.
  2. While pasta cooks, prepare hard-boiled eggs and chop scallions; rinse peas if frozen.
  3. In a large bowl, combine cooked pasta with tuna, beans, eggs, scallions, and peas.
  4. In another bowl, whisk together cottage cheese, mayo, vinegar, mustard, and spices until smooth.
  5. Pour dressing over pasta mixture; gently fold until well-coated. Cover and chill for at least 15 minutes before serving.

Nutrition

  • Serving Size: 1 cup (240g)
  • Calories: 380
  • Sugar: 3g
  • Sodium: 620mg
  • Fat: 14g
  • Saturated Fat: 3g
  • Unsaturated Fat: 9g
  • Trans Fat: 0g
  • Carbohydrates: 42g
  • Fiber: 6g
  • Protein: 28g
  • Cholesterol: 160mg
